WebIn April 2024 the UK government launched the UK Shared Prosperity Fund (UKSPF). The UKSPF is a central pillar of the UK government's Levelling Up agenda and provides £2.6 billion of funding for local investment across the UK by March 2025. WebShared Prosperity: Concepts, Data, and Some Policy Examples* “Shared prosperity” has become a common phrase in the development policy discourse. This short paper provides its most widely used operational definition – the growth rate in the average income of the poorest 40 percent of a country’s population – and describes its origins. WebIn much of the world today, the incomes of the poor are growing. Shared prosperity, defined as the average annual growth in income or consumption of the poorest 40 percent (the bottom 40) within each country, was positive in 70 out of the 91 economies for which data is available.
